The San Francisco 49ers are preparing for their Week 4 contest against the Arizona Cardinals on Sunday at Levi's Stadium in Santa Clara, California.
Deebo Samuel continues to rack up the absences. For the third time this week, the wide receiver missed practice. He did not participate in Monday's bonus practice or Wednesday's session. Samuel was on the field for the team's walk-through on Thursday but left for the weight room once his teammates started stretching in preparation for practice.
Linebacker
Dre Greenlaw returned to practice for the first time this week after missing time due to an ankle injury. Wide receiver
Brandon Aiyuk (shoulder) shed his blue no-contact jersey, a sign that he could be nearing a return after being among the 49ers' inactives last week against the New York Giants.
Jauan Jennings did not practice but was seen on a side field working alongside fellow receiver
Danny Gray, who is currently on injured reserve due to an SC joint sprain.
Tackle
Trent Williams returned to practice after having Wednesday off.
Below are Thursday's practice participation reports for both the 49ers and Cardinals, which were provided by the 49ers Communications staff.
San Francisco 49ers Thursday Practice
Did Not Participate In Practice
WR Jauan Jennings (shin), WR Deebo Samuel (ribs, knee)
Limited Participation in Practice
WR Brandon Aiyuk (shoulder), LB
Demetrius Flannigan-Fowles (ankle), LB Dre Greenlaw (ankle), CB
Ambry Thomas (knee)
Arizona Cardinals Thursday Practice
Did Not Participate In Practice
DE Jonathan Ledbetter (finger), LB Josh Woods (ankle)
Limited Participation in Practice
LB Krys Barnes (finger), WR Marquise Brown (thumb), RB Keaontay Ingram (neck)
Full Participation in Practice
T Kelvin Beachum (hand), LB Zaven Collins (eye), RB James Conner (back)
